Major National Organizations
- St John Ambulance UK: This is arguably the most well-known first aid charity in the UK.
- Pros: Highly reputable, extensive network of training centers across the UK, wide range of accredited courses First Aid at Work, Paediatric First Aid, Mental Health First Aid, strong focus on community services and volunteering. Their certifications are widely recognized.
- Cons: Courses can sometimes be more expensive than smaller providers, and booking popular courses might require advance planning.
- Key Differentiator: Decades of experience, national coverage, and significant involvement in event medical support.
- British Red Cross UK: Another prominent humanitarian organization offering first aid training.
- Pros: Strong reputation, diverse course offerings including online, in-person, and blended formats, focus on humanitarian principles, and resources for a wide array of emergency situations. They also offer free resources and apps.
- Cons: Similar to St John Ambulance, their courses might be at a premium price point, and availability can vary.
- Key Differentiator: Broad humanitarian mission, strong emphasis on global emergency response and education.
- Royal Life Saving Society UK RLSS UK: While primarily focused on water safety and lifeguarding, they also offer first aid courses relevant to water environments and broader scenarios.
- Pros: Specialization in water-related first aid, highly relevant for specific industries leisure centers, aquatic facilities.
- Cons: Less general first aid focus compared to St John Ambulance or British Red Cross.
- Key Differentiator: Niche expertise in lifesaving and water safety.

Cooksonfirstaid.org and Accreditation
The mention of “accredited training courses” on Cooksonfirstaid.org is a crucial indicator of the quality and recognition of their certifications.
In the UK, first aid qualifications often need to meet specific standards to be valid for workplace compliance or professional requirements.
Understanding Accreditation
- Regulatory Bodies: In the UK, many workplace first aid qualifications are regulated by bodies such as Ofqual The Office of Qualifications and Examinations Regulation. This ensures that qualifications are consistent in quality and recognized across different industries.
- Awarding Bodies: Training providers like Cookson First Aid typically work with recognized Awarding Bodies e.g., Qualsafe Awards, Highfield Qualifications, First Aid Awards who develop the course specifications and quality assure the delivery. The certificates issued would come from these awarding bodies, demonstrating adherence to national standards.
- Importance of Accreditation:
- Workplace Compliance: Employers are legally obligated under the Health and Safety First-Aid Regulations 1981 to provide adequate first aid arrangements. Accredited courses ensure that the training meets the standards required for workplace first aiders.
- Professional Recognition: For individuals, an accredited certificate is recognized by employers and professional bodies, enhancing their CV and demonstrating competence.
- Quality Assurance: Accreditation means that the course content, teaching methods, assessment processes, and instructor qualifications have been rigorously vetted and meet established benchmarks for quality and effectiveness.
